adenylyl-sulfate reductase  M-CSA #123

Adenylylsulfate (adenosine 5'-phosphosulfate) reductase (APS reductase) from Archaeoglobus fulgidus catalyses the reversible reduction of APS to sulfite and AMP. This pathway provides sulfate which serves as a terminal electron acceptor of an anaerobic respiratory electron transfer chain. Electrons are also provided for anoxygenic photosynthesis and denitrification.
